On the weekend of July 4-6, 2003, the USA Deaf Team Handball (USADTH), under the auspices of the USA Deaf Sports Federation, hosted the successful America Cup event at Gallaudet University, Washington, DC. It was amazingly the first International team handball tournament here in our good ole America. This is notable since larger hearing organizations have yet to host any kind of international team handball competitions here in USA. The results of the American Cup were the Croatian team placing first place, the second place went to Denmark and the two USA teams placed third and fourth. See the results of games and leaders below.
Result of America Cup Games:
Game 1: July 4 at 13:00
Croatia: 39 USA Blue: 22
Game 2: July 4 at 14:30
Denmark: 18 USA Red: 17
Game 3: July 5 at 9:30 USA Blue: 21 USA Red: 29
Game 4: July 5 at 11:00
Croatia: 36 Denmark 22
Game 5: July 5 at 15:00
Denmark 31 USA Blue: 23
Game 6: July 5 at 16:30
USA Red: 25 Croatia: 32
Game 7: July 6 at 9:00 (3rd/4th Place)
USA Red:33 USA Blue: 27
Game 8: July 6 at 11:00 (Championship)
Croatia: 34 Denmark 19
